Basics

  • An abbreviation for Carbon DiOxoide Equivalent
  • A Unit used in Carbon Accounting to represent the ammount of Carbon Dioxide, (or another greenhouse gas measured as the equivalent ammount of Carbon Dioxide) emitted by an entity
  • For most use cases, the 100-year Global Warming Potential of a gaseous emission is used to derive CO2e.
